- AggregationIndex: defineAggregate before init no longer forces a backfill. init reconciles instead of clobbering: the app definition wins, persisted state is adopted on hash match, a write landing pre-adoption forces an exact rescan, and a successful state load clears the backfill flag. New ready() settles every adoption decision before query paths consult backfill state. - brainy: backfills are single-flight and batched. Concurrent queries share one store walk and every pending aggregate fills from that same walk; the old behavior let each concurrent query wipe the others' partial state and start its own full walk, so a store under steady aggregate traffic never converged. queryAggregate also waits for persisted definitions before deciding an aggregate does not exist. - paramValidation: recordQuery is telemetry-only. The duration-based cap ratchet (x0.8 per recorded query while lifetime-average exceeded 1s, floored at 1000 - below the documented 10000 auto floor, reported under a stale basis label) is removed; the cap comes from its construction-time basis or explicit overrides alone. - storage: __aggregation_* and singleton system keys (brainy:entityIdMapper) are recognized before the unknown-key warning fires; routing is unchanged. - docs: find-limits cap-immutability note, aggregation reopen/adoption semantics, RELEASES.md 8.5.1 entry. |
